Output f57420fbd81a388741925a29ea5a45e5ccf47d0acc5f58edfc46b5f92a6b0432:0

value
996067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e2b8427b86b0cff4ffbe612d1b5183dfd982fe OP_EQUAL
address
3HMs57TYAeyfUikoX9WUyqPdHon2YhTGTS
transaction
f57420fbd81a388741925a29ea5a45e5ccf47d0acc5f58edfc46b5f92a6b0432
spent
true